Vital Implements for Data-Driven SEO Analysis
Superior SEO examination centers on the correct tools, which empower companies to extract valuable insights from their data. Among the essential tools, Google Analytics stands out, supplying broad website traffic data and audience behavior tracking. This tool enables enterprises to understand their audience and refine content accordingly. Another vital resource is SEMrush, which presents keyword research, site audits, and competitive analysis, supporting organizations spot opportunities and threats in their SEO efforts. Ahrefs also plays an important role, particularly in backlink analysis, enabling users to assess their link profiles and understand their rival strategies. Additionally, Moz supplies valuable insights into domain authority and keyword rankings, while Screaming Frog assists with technical SEO audits, revealing on-site issues that may obstruct performance. Together, these tools form a robust foundation for impactful data-driven SEO analysis, ensuring enterprises can make strategic decisions to enhance their search engine rankings.

Long-Tail Keywords Relevance
Long-tail related information keywords are essential in developing an successful SEO strategy. These terms, typically containing three or more copyright, serve specific search intents, attracting highly targeted traffic. Unlike broad keywords, long-tail variations face less competition, enabling websites to rank higher in search results. By identifying valuable long-tail keywords, businesses can engage users who are further along in their buying journey, ultimately boosting customer actions. Leveraging analytics-based tools to study search volume and relevance helps in selecting the most effective keywords. Naturally including these terms into content not only enhances SEO but also enhances user experience, as the content aligns more closely with what potential customers are searching for.

Connecting Keywords To Purpose
Mapping keywords to user intent is a fundamental step in strengthening SEO methods. This technique involves reviewing the motivations behind user searches to align content effectively with user expectations. By sorting keywords into informational, navigational, and transactional intents, companies can modify their content to fulfill distinct user needs. For instance, informational keywords may prompt blog posts or guides, while transactional keywords could route to product pages or service deliverables. Understanding these nuances allows companies to create targeted content that resonates with their community, ultimately amplifying higher engagement and conversion rates. Embedding data-driven insights into keyword mapping not only strengthens search visibility but also fosters a more deep connection with potential customers. This alignment is vital for sustained SEO success.
How to Evaluate Performance in Data-Based SEO
Evaluating achievement in data-driven SEO demands a structured approach to analyze performance data. Critical performance measures (KPIs) such as natural search traffic, keyword rankings, and conversion rates provide important information into SEO performance. Tracking shifts in these indicators over time enables a comprehensive assessment of approaches and methods.
In addition, employing tools like Google Analytics and Search Console can help measure user behavior and involvement, revealing how visitors interact with content. Bounce rates and average session duration also serve as benchmarks of content relevance and user satisfaction.
Another important aspect involves analyzing backlinks and domain authority, which reflect the site's credibility and influence. Constantly checking these statistics helps SEO professionals to determine sound adjustments, supporting progressive improvement. Ultimately, a evidence-based approach empowers teams to refine their plans, adapt to changing algorithms, and achieve consistent growth in search engine rankings.
